DC 37 is celebrating 65 years of struggle

Six and a half decades of fighting for workers’ rights is something to celebrate! District Council 37 of the American Federation of State, County and Municipal Employees was born in October 1944, and the union is holding events to commemorate its 65th anniversary all year in 2009.

Throughout October, DC 37 headquarters at 125 Barclay St. will showcase a gallery exhibit entitled, “A Pictorial Journey through DC 37 History: The Workforce That Shaped New York City.” The exhibit will include photographs, text and graphic depictions of the union’s struggles and victories.

Locals are encouraged to contribute to this exhibit by donating photographs of events, leaders and members, historic and current; tools, machines and equipment that were used in union trades; old uniforms, garments, hats and picket signs; old contracts, manuals, or dues books; old or new union lapel and message pins or buttons; and videos produced by locals of shop stewards, political action and union events.

The goal of the display is to convey to viewers the history of DC 37 — where it came from, what it is now, and its future aspirations. This is an excellent opportunity for each local to share its unique background and history and be a part of a special moment in DC 37 history.
